1. Classic Low Pony With A Prep-School Bow

Item 1

Timeless, polished, and fast — this low pony gives serious honor-roll energy. The bow adds instant personality without trying too hard, and the sleek base keeps flyaways in check between classes.

Best For

  • Hair lengths: Medium to long
  • Occasions: Picture day, presentations, or any “I’ve got this” moment

Style Tip

Smooth strands with a pea-size of Garnier Fructis Sleek & Shine and brush into a low pony using a Conair boar-bristle brush. Tie a thin elastic first, then layer a ribboned scrunchie so it stays put through the whole school day.

Color Combos

  • Ribbons: Navy on brunettes, dusty pink on blondes
  • Glaze: Clear gloss for extra shine without darkening

It’s the hairstyle that whispers “organized” even when your planner says otherwise.

2. Half-Up Heart Braid That Steals The Hallway

Item 2

This sweet half-up braid forms a subtle heart shape and feels TikTok-cute without the 20-minute tutorial. It frames the face and keeps the top layer off your eyes for note-taking and lab goggles.

Hair Length Match

  • Best on shoulder-length to long hair with light layers

Style Tip

Create two small side braids, flip and pin them into a heart at the back with Scünci mini bobby pins. Mist with Tresemmé Compressed Micro Mist Level 2 for flexible hold that doesn’t crunch.

Wear it on Friday and expect compliments at every locker stop.

4. Sleek Middle-Part Braid That Means Business

Item 4

Clean lines and a center part give instant academic-chic. A single sleek braid feels grown-up yet practical — no hair in your lip gloss, ever.

Style Tip

Comb in Eco Style Olive Oil Gel along the part and hairline, then braid low and secure. Finish the tail with a light press of Moroccanoil Treatment Light for frizz control.

Accent Detail

Add a thin gold snap clip at the part for a minimalist sparkle that reads editor-approved.

This is the “aced the quiz” energy your Monday needs.

7. Dutch Pigtail Braids That Survive PE

Item 7

Sporty, symmetrical, and cute — Dutch braids lock everything down while looking intentional. They also make great braid waves the next day.

Hair Length Match

  • Best from shoulder length to long; layers should be minimal

Style Tip

Prep with Not Your Mother’s Plumping Mousse for grip, then braid tight and secure ends with snag-free elastics. Pancake the edges slightly for volume.

Wear them for gym and still look adorable at study hall, IMO.

14. Double Rope Braids, Science-Lab Safe

Item 14

Rope braids twist fast, look sleek, and resist frizz under goggles. They give futuristic-cute while keeping hair secure.

Style Tip

Create a center part, twist two sections per side, wrap them around each other, and secure low. Use TIGI Bed Head Wax Stick on edges for a clean line.

Accent Detail

Finish with tiny metallic elastics for subtle sparkle.

They’re the efficient braids you’ll remake all week, trust me.

17. Low Braided Bun With Ribbon Threads

Item 17

This style blends balletcore and school-uniform chic. The braided texture peeks through the bun while ribbon threads tie in your color scheme.

Style Tip

Braid a low pony, thread a thin ribbon through a few links, then spiral into a bun and pin. Lightly mist with Moroccanoil Luminous Hairspray Medium.

Color Combos

  • Ribbons: Burgundy, cream, or navy to match school colors

It’s the tidy, A+ bun your planner would approve of.

Frequently Asked Questions

Q: What defines a “school vibes” hairstyle?

It’s a look that’s cute, quick, and practical enough for long days and activities. Think secure, minimal heat, and details like ribbons or clips that elevate without extra effort.

Q: Who do these styles suit best?

They’re designed for students with busy schedules and all hair types. You’ll find options for short, medium, long, straight, wavy, curly, and coily textures.

Q: How do I make these styles last all day?

Start with light hold products and secure with quality elastics or pins. A quick hairspray mist and a mini touch-up kit (elastic, bobby pin, travel brush) in your backpack keep things neat.

Q: What products should I prioritize on a student budget?

Grab a heat protectant, a flexible hairspray, and a light hair oil — they cover 90% of looks. Drugstore staples like Tresemmé, Garnier, and Not Your Mother’s perform well for the price.

Q: How do I ask for these styles at the salon?

Bring photos and mention key details like “face-framing layers,” “curtain bangs,” or “subtle money piece.” For color, ask for soft ribbons or a clear gloss to enhance shine without drastic changes.
